And tomorrow, the IMF holds a conference on digital currencies and cross-border payment systems" The Bretton Woods system was a big modification on the planet's financial system. Bretton Woods Era. The agreement in 1944 recognized centralized monetary management rules between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a variety of Western European nations. Basically, the world's economy was in disarray after The second world war,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ied nations collected in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. Pegs.

Treasury department authorities Harry Dexter White. Numerous historians think the closed-door Bretton Woods meeting centralized the whole world's monetary system (fox news gabrielle). On the conference's final day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of guidelines for the world's financial system and conjured up the World Bank Group and the IMF. Essentially, due to the fact that the U.S. managed more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would count on gold and the U.S. dollar. Nevertheless, Richard Nixon shocked the world when he removed the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. As quickly as the Bretton Woods system was up and running, a number of people criticized the strategy and stated the Bretton Woods meeting and subsequent creations reinforced world inflation.

The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his articles like "End the IMF" were extremely controversial to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t stated that he composed thoroughly about how the intro of the IMF had actually caused enormous national currency declines. Hazlitt explained the British pound lost a third of its value over night in 1949. "In the years from the end of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ies depreciated," the economist det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ar showed a loss in internal purchasing power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
